We are recruiting a Service Controller for our reputable client on a permanent basis.

Hours: Monday to Friday, 8am – 5pm

About our Client hiring a Service Co-ordinator: Our client is seeking an experienced Service Co-ordinator to support the Service Manager and workshop team. This role would suit someone from a Plant, Agricultural, Quarry, HGV or similar heavy industry background who is looking to move off the tools into an office-based service role.

Key Responsibilities as a Service Co-ordinator:

  • Support the Service Manager with the daily running of the service department
  • Provide technical advice and support to engineers
  • Help improve service department performance and efficiency
  • Liaise with engineers, workshop staff and management
  • Assist with service planning, job allocation and workflow
  • Maintain high standards of organisation, communication and customer service

Requirements for the Service Co-ordinator role:

  • Hands-on engineering, fitting or mechanical experience would be beneficial
  • Strong technical understanding of heavy equipment or machinery
  • Able to support engineers with technical queries
  • Confident working in an office-based service environment
  • Previous experience as a Service Supervisor, Workshop Supervisor, Service Controller, Workshop Controller or Service Coordinator would be advantageous
